These are original VHS tapes, not copies. I have Video Workshop #17 for the E9th tuning. It goes into detail on playing two songs and backing the singer. The two songs are All My Ex's Live in Texas and Forever and Ever Amen.

I have the C6th Video Workshop that contains parts one and two. The instruction starts at the beginning under the assumption that you know nothing at all about the C6 tuning. Jeff explains how it is easy to play and understand and explains why it is a lot easier to learn than the E9th tuning.
